History of Wildlife Management Education Fund:

The entire program was conceived and developed by a coalition of hunters, anglers and conservationists working together with livestock and agriculture organizations and the DOW almost twenty years ago.

Since the first council was created in 1998, members have worked to develop the educational campaign. A professional marketing firm was retained through the state’s bid process in 2006 to work directly with the council to help create the educational programming and conduct the media purchasing.

The council’s initial research indicated that the public had very little understanding and knowledge about wildlife management, hunting and fishing in the state. Most of the public, including some hunters and anglers, did not even know that wildlife management is funded primarily by the sale of licenses.

The message and how it is presented has evolved over the years since 1998 but the main idea has not. The original plan for the council and fund was to help all Colorado citizens understand how the wildlife of Colorado, that is so important to us all, is managed and how that management in funded in a large way by Anglers and Hunters instead of tax dollars.
